What is the ELOVL2 gene?
Very-long-chain fatty-acid elongase involved in EPA, DPA, DHA, and long-chain PUFA handling.

omega-3 long-chain PUFA response tendency
rs953413 A in ELOVL2 is associated with altered EPA/DHA proportions and a stronger EPA or omega-3 index increase after fish-oil supplementation.
ELOVL2 rs953413 A is staged as a fish-oil response and long-chain omega-3 PUFA biomarker allele.

Biomarkers to validate
ApoB
Shows the number of atherogenic particles more directly than total cholesterol.
LDL-C, HDL-C, and triglycerides
Gives the basic lipid pattern that DNA can help contextualize.
Lp(a) or liver enzymes when relevant
Adds context for inherited lipid risk or liver lipid handling.
